    The role:


    Our client based in Worcestershire are the leading supplier for all blown stone wool fire barrier and insulation installations for both domestic and commercial clients.

    They operate on a national level and are seeking to hire a Trainee Installation Technician who has experience in the construction industry and is keen to lend these skills to their specialist service.

    As the Trainee Installation Technician, you will be responsible for meeting clients on a face-to-face basis and always offering a professional and knowledgeable service.

    The ideal candidate will have minimum 2 years' experience within the construction industry and possess a sound knowledge of and experience with power tools and working as part of a team on busy construction sites.

    Other experience within the construction industry may be considered for the right candidate.


    Full training will be provided with the role, but the opportunity to grow and forge a long-standing career is very much on offer with a clear career progression laid in front of you from day one.

    Although the role is based in Worcestershire, daily travel will form a large part of this role. This will occasionally involve an overnight stay and driving for up to 3 hours to reach your destination. Please be mindful when applying for this role that this is a non-negotiable part of the role.

    A company vehicle will be provided and all costs will be covered for the times when you stay away from site.

    Main duties and responsibilities:

    Undertake all duties in accordance with the Company's training programme
    Undertake all aspects of the blown insulation installation cycle
    Check the jobs calendar on a daily basis to plan for upcoming installations
    Conduct surveys at both domestic and commercial sites, as required
    Prior to use, check all equipment e.g., ladders, harnesses etc. is fit for use
    Check and load materials into vehicles in preparation for installations
    Safely drive company vehicles to various locations within the UK, strictly adhering to speed limits and the Highway Code
    Liaise with customers throughout the installation cycle, explaining what the installation will involve and ensuring expectations are met and exceeded
    Set up machinery and materials on site safely and correctly
    Removal of any existing insulation material, where necessary
    Drill to specified drill patterns, where required
    Safe and effective installation of blown materials into building voids on both domestic and commercial sites using machinery provided
    Carry out quality checks throughout installation and on completion of each job
    Completion of job report forms and submissions of form to the office
    Ensure all sites remain clean, tidy, and free from obstructions at all times
    Strictly adhere to all Health and Safety procedures, as per the Company's Health & Safety policy and procedures
    Safely carry out moderate-heavy lifting, as required
    Take reasonable precautions and maintain a high standard of health and safety awareness at all times
    Notify the Operations Director of any health and safety concerns or accidents immediately
    Ensure a consistently high-quality standard of work and customer service
    Prior to use, ensure Company vehicles are fit for use by conducting daily vehicle checks
    Submit regular vehicle check forms to the Operations Director
    Make the Operations Director aware of any vehicle defects or issues as soon as they arise
    Ensure that stock is checked and counted on a regular basis and send stock information to the Business Support Services team for recording
    Receive, reconcile, and store new stock deliveries
